SRC is looking for an individual that will be part of a team tasked with Navy formal and informal cryptologic training. Job responsibilities include providing shipboard and classroom instruction as well as curriculum design and development. This specific position will be directly supporting the Naval Information Warfare Center in developing, testing, maintaining and delivering cryptologic training products and providing instruction on the related materials as a Subject Matter Expert.

PRIMARY D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:



  • Tests hardware and software releases for quality assurance
  • Performs training of complex technical skills in accordance with Navy standards in both formal and informal environments
  • Designs and develops curriculum in accordance with NAVEDTRA standards
  • Develops training materials to include: Lesson Plans, Instructor, Student, and Trainee guides
  • Performs curriculum design, audits, and revisions
  • Evaluates and assesses Learning Objectives (LO), Terminal Objectives (TO), and Enabling Objectives (EO)
  • Develops and maintains Plan of Action and Milestones (POAM) & Course Master Schedule (CMS)
